Estes Park Wool Market

For those of you that may not have heard, I will be teaching at the 2024 Estes Park Wool Market. If you have followed my blog for a while you may have seen a post or two about my visits to this fun event that is practically in my backyard. Estes Park is a 40+ minute drive from my house. It is a gorgeous drive too, especially in June.

In 2024 the workshop days are June 6 & 7 and the vendor marketplace is June 8 & 9. I will be teaching 3 workshops there, 2 crochet and 1 needle felting. Registration for workshops is open now on the Wool Market website.

Thursday, June 6 I’ll be teaching 2 Crochet Workshops.

Stitch Chart Bootcamp (9 a.m. – Noon): For those of you that have been stymied by stitch charts, this is the perfect workshop to help you unravel them. Once you have finished this workshop you will have the skills to tackle any stitch chart and create crochet projects from them that will please you. The handout for the workshop will include lots of fun stitch charts for you to work from while attending and afterward.

Inside Out Rectangles (1 p.m. – 4 p.m.): Working from the center out in rounds is my favorite way to create crochet projects. I especially love the way it gives a lovely edge to the finished project. Rectangles worked in square rounds are really handy. They can be placemats, towels, scarves, wraps, tablecloths, throws and blankets. But how do you know what size of a foundation to start with to get the size rectangle you want. In this workshop you will learn everything you need to know to always get the size rectangle you were aiming for, as well as some fun stitch patterns to work your rectangles in.

Friday, June 7 I’ll be teaching 1 Needle Felting Workshop.

Needle Felting in 3D (9 a.m. – Noon): Needle Felting is the perfect way to create sculptural objects. You don’t have to worry about expensive tools, materials or finding a kiln to fire your pieces. With Needle Felting you can play with shape and color easily and affordably. Make everything from toys to jewelry to art. You don’t need to be experienced with needle felting to be able to step right into this craft and begin making fun 3 dimensional shapes that you can turn into anything you want.
